Career milestones

Dev-Afrique / DRC

2025 – Present

Senior Consultant, Digital Health & IM Workstream Lead — geospatial and digital health capacity assessment across DRC provinces; WBS, RACI, and budget frameworks; stakeholder mapping across government, donors, and partners; alignment with the national health information management landscape.

IOM Myanmar

2025 – 2026

IM and Health Data Management Consultant — mission-level TIP/VoT health data mandate: MiMOSA, IOM data protection, multi-source integration; designed and shipped VISTA MMR (vistammr.vercel.app) for real-time victim health dashboards; Python pipelines from Kobo/Excel, YAML standardization, Power BI, and SOPs for sustained governance.

IOM Pacific (FSM & RMI)

2024 – 2025

Information Management Officer, Disaster Risk Reduction — delivered the DRM DataHub: Asset Registry, Early Warning, Kobo server, repository, and 5W stakeholder tracking; DataHub Sync Jobs (C#) for automated field-to-central SQL sync; 99% data security compliance, training, and NDMA handover in FSM and RMI.

IOM Niger (NCCI)

2021 – 2023

Information Management Officer — community cohesion health data and IM platform (SQL Server, Power BI, Kobo, Activity Info); fully automated Community Stability Index reporting; NCCI grant database; led three IM assistants and cross-unit data integration for the programme.

IOM Haiti (TDY-STA)

2023

CCCM & Shelter/NFI in Port-au-Prince — mission IM strategy, cluster tools aligned with global standards, map templates and partner training, OCHA and Shelter Cluster dashboards, and multi-partner assessment consolidation.

GRID3 (CIESIN / Columbia University)

2020 – 2021

DRC National Coordinator and Digital Health Programme Lead — country-level coordination of national digital health and geospatial work with the Ministry of Health, UNOPS, and CIESIN: seven programme budgets (~USD 1M), 10+ projects, health facility mapping with 30 field mappers, Geospatial Steering and Technical Committee, and interoperability and data-sharing frameworks with government and donors.
